Openen van access bestand vanuit Access

Status
Niet open voor verdere reacties.

tuning4you

Gebruiker
Lid geworden
3 jun 2007
Berichten
328
Om een access bestand te openen vanuit een access formulier werd er een marco toegevoegd.
Dit maakt gebruik van de opdrachtregel C:\Program Files\Microsoft Office\OFFICE10\msaccess.exe o:\database.mdb.

Het probleem is dat sommige gebruikers reeds access 2003 hebben en dan een foutmelding krijgen omdat dit OFFICE11 is.

Iemand een oplossing?
 
Je kan met het DIR commando controleren of Access in Office10 bestaat zoniet dan gebruik je Office11.
Code:
if len(dir("C:\Program Files\Microsoft Office\OFFICE10\msaccess.exe"))=0 then 'Bestaat niet
    'Gebruik C:\Program Files\Microsoft Office\OFFICE11\msaccess.exe
else
    'Gebruik C:\Program Files\Microsoft Office\OFFICE10\msaccess.exe
endif
Enjoy!
 
de getoonde oplossing is in VBA maar je kan ook in macro's een IF-THEN constructie opnemen.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an